## Capacity Note: Image Slimming

Plugin authors building on the Cratebox runtime should assume base images get slimmed before deploy. The slimming pass strips debug symbols, docs, and locale data, then re-layers; anything your plugin needs at runtime must be declared, or it will be pruned. Budget-wise, slimmed images cut registry storage roughly in half and shorten cold pulls on the Vexhall cluster. Pruning aggressiveness and layer caps are controlled by the constants below.

tuning table, faduf-baduf:
PRIORITIES = {
    "ulavan": 191,
    "silys": 750,
    "goriel": 238,
    "kelmir": 66,
    "wendor": 432,
}

Leadership Review Briefing — Loyalty Overhaul

Heads of department: the Ambermark loyalty programme will be replaced by a tiered points model in Q2. Migration covers 410K members; legacy points convert at par. Comms plan drafted; app changes on track. Cost neutral by year two. Strategic intent behind the overhaul is summarised in the confidential note below.

internal memo for kawip-hadug: Headcount on the Wenwyn team goes from 7 to 140 by the end of January. Gross margin on Wenwyn came in at 20 percent against a plan of 15 percent.

Quick overview of Switchyard, our feature-flag rollout framework. If you're on call: flags ramp automatically in stages, and a bad health signal freezes the ramp — no heroics needed at 3am. You can force a rollback from the Switchyard console, which takes effect within one polling cycle. The ramp stages and health thresholds are defined by the constants below.

constants for fajop-tahaf:
RATE_LIMITS = {
    "holael": 2,
    "oliael": 10,
    "druael": 10,
    "wenwyn": 10,
}

## Authentication

Heads up: the Splitlark assignment service doesn't do OAuth — every request to the experiment-assignment endpoint carries a static internal key in the `X-Splitlark-Auth` header. Keys are scoped read-only for assignment lookups, so worst case an attacker can see bucket names, not flip them. Rotation happens quarterly via the platform vault. For your review environment, use the staging key below.

gateway credential: kto23_LX9A4ys6i4nzHtpOLNLodKK